Transaction 7885a483c033e8f71b5018cec58889208ee2f39553ee6f3da63e42d7512fbe85

1 Input
2 Outputs
  • 7885a483c033e8f71b5018cec58889208ee2f39553ee6f3da63e42d7512fbe85:0
  • value  433164627
    address  156Sb7rnr6WmLGXoJiymaqYMvdFj3VDPR8
  • 7885a483c033e8f71b5018cec58889208ee2f39553ee6f3da63e42d7512fbe85:1
  • value  1253256
    address  1JwtQSr2iWrKn24RQnNFRWbXx5orB6tuJf